This might help, another (the third) licensed club under the Manly-Warringah banner. The amalgamation with the well located (in the middle of the Chatswood CBD) Chatswood Club:

IMG_0981.webp


Gradually the LC is building up its asset base and presumably its income stream. That helps, although they’re still paying about $700k a year in rent to the new owners of the leagues’ club.
 
Big 5?

Broncos last title was 2006, Bulldogs 2004.

Roosters and Melbourne have 3 titles each the last 20 years we have 2.

5 teams outside the "Big 5" have won titles since the Broncos last title and 8 teams in total.

That is 6 and 9 for the Bulldogs.

Heck the Tigers have won a comp more recently that the Dogs.
